▣ Product Specifications
• Manufacturer: Exclusive Italian Mill, Italy
• Article: CINCICASH
• Fiber Content: 20% Sable, 80% Cashmere
• Yarn Category: Lace Weight / Fine Luxury Yarn
• Yarn Count: 2/11
• Yardage: approx. 550 m / 640 yd per 100 g (3.52 oz)
• Formats: Balls (BY DEFAULT) or Cones (PLEASE PURCHASE)
• Origin: Made in Italy

⋔ Swatch Notes
I knitted my sample in one strand using US size 4 needles, and I was genuinely, very pleasantly impressed by how dramatically the fabric changed while I was washing it and after washing. The swatch changed almost before my eyes: the yarn bloomed heavily, developed a beautiful halo, and the strand appeared to increase almost two times in volume as it opened up. It became much fluffier even while still wet.

That means this yarn can absolutely be knitted in one strand if you want a light, warm, almost weightless, airy fabric with a very noticeable soft halo. If you prefer a warmer or more winter-ready result, it also works beautifully in two strands.

One important note: this yarn does not hold ribbing well. It is much better suited to soft, airy fabrics than to structured ribbed edges. It is also an excellent yarn to use as a carry-along with almost anything, because it immediately elevates the finished fabric with a beautiful bloom, a silky-soft touch, and a completely non-prickly feel. The hand is incredibly pleasant, and the final effect is truly luxurious.

In my experience, the melange shade 2228 feels noticeably fuller and puffier than the solid grey shade 2229, even though both are technically the same yarn by weight. This may be due to the different color treatment, although that is simply my personal impression.

⋔ Recommended Yarn Usage
• Hat or beanie: approx. 100 g
• Shawl or wrap: approx. 150–250 g
• Scarf or cowl: approx. 120–220 g
• Lightweight sweater (S–M): approx. 250–350 g
• Sweater (L–XL): approx. 350–500 g
• Long cardigan: approx. 450–650 g

✦ Recommended Needles / Hooks
• Single strand: start around US 4 / 3.5 mm for an airy light fabric
• Two strands: start around 4.5–5.0 mm
• Swatching is essential, especially because this yarn blooms dramatically during washing and after washing

⫯ Weaving Suitability
• Suitable for soft, lightweight luxury weaving projects
• Beautiful for scarves, wraps, and refined apparel fabrics
• Best for textiles where softness and elegance are the priority

⟳ Care Instructions
• Hand wash cold with gentle cashmere or wool detergent
• Do not wring or twist
• Lay flat to dry and reshape while damp
• Store folded rather than hanging
• Wash swatch before final sizing calculations
